No Retry Plugini

No Retry Plugini ; İsminden de birşey anlaşılmıyorsa ben bu oyunu bırakırım :) :) Şaka bir yana :) Evet arkadaşlar bu plugin sayesinde server'ınızda retry çekme yasağı koyuyorsunuz.Bu arada bilmeyen arkadaşlar için tekrar hatırlatalım Retry : Server'dan çıkış yaparak tekrar oyuna bağlanmak demektir.Peki bunun sw'ye ne gibi bir zararı olabilir.Çok zararı var arkadaşlar server'ınızda acayip derecede lagg ve loss yaratır çünkü player çıkıp girerse server bunu 2 kişi olarak algılar 32 kişinin aynı anda retry çektiğini düşünsenize :)


Cvar komutları ;
  • amx_retrykick (0/1) - Retry çekenleri kickler ( Varsayılan : 0 )
  • amx_retrychat (0/1) - Retry çekimi kullanımını mesaj olarak gösterme (yada onun gibi birşey :)) - ( Varsayılan : 1 )
  • amx_retrykickmsg - Oyuncuyu neden kicklediğini gösteren mesaj ( Varsayılan Mesaj : "RETRY CEKMEK YASAKTIR.!" )

Kurulumu ;
  • "no_retry.amxx" dosyasını /plugins içine atın.
  • "no_retry.sma" dosyasını /scripting içine atın.
  • "no_retry.amxx" yazısınıda /configs/plugins.ini 'nin en alt satırına ekleyin.
  • Son olarak res atın veya map değiştirin.

19 yorum:

  1. Bu Çok İyi Oldu İşte :) Özellikle Surf ve DeathRun Server'larda Çok İşe Yarıyor :)

    YanıtlaSil
  2. Teşekkürler, erdener eline sağlık.

    YanıtlaSil
  3. Rica ederim uFuk abi hiç sorun değiL :)

    YanıtlaSil
  4. Çok tşk ederim.. Bizim Dr Serverde T olanlar sıkıldıgı için retry çekiyor. Onu engellemek için guzel bir oneri Tşk'Ler..!

    YanıtlaSil
  5. mp_roundtime 50 yaparsan da retry çekenler doğarak başlayamaz :)

    YanıtlaSil
  6. Couldnt agree more with that, very attractive article

    YanıtlaSil
  7. Link ölmüş..

    YanıtlaSil
  8. Hocam Plugini Türkçe Hali Yokmu

    YanıtlaSil
  9. Peki Eklentiyi Türkçe Yapmak İçin Hangi Bölümleri Değiştirmem Gerek ?

    YanıtlaSil
  10. @Mustafa Ceylan

    register_cvar("amx_retrymsg","No retry allowed here, %s")
    register_cvar("amx_retrykickmsg","Too fast reconnect is not allowed")
    register_cvar("amx_retrychatmsg","%s was kicked: reconnect in %t seconds")

    YanıtlaSil
  11. Bunları Yaptım Ve Panele Yükledim Fakat Hicbirsey Değişmedi ?

    Daha Once Eklentiyi Yuklemıştım İngilizce Sonra Eklentinin Adını Değiştirdim Türkçeye Çevirdim yükledim Yine İngilizce Oldu

    YanıtlaSil
  12. @Mustafa Ceylan

    gerekli yerleri sma dosyasında Türkçe yaptıktan sonra o sma'yı amxx çevirmen gerek. Amx çevirmek için burayı kullanabilirsin; http://www.amxmodx.org/webcompiler.cgi

    YanıtlaSil
  13. Malesef CSOYUNCU PANELi sadece .sma uzantılı dosyaları kabul ediyor ?

    YanıtlaSil
  14. @Mustafa Ceylan

    server eklentileri .amxx üzerinden çalışır. Sma dosyası değil. Adamlar kafa bulur gibi sadece sma dosyası izni vermiş ya :D

    bence sen csduragi firmasından sw al.

    YanıtlaSil
  15. :D 2 Yıldır Ne Çileler Çekiyorum Bir Bilsen Csduragındaydım Hergün Saldırı Yiyorduk CSOYUNCUYA geçtim burdada eklenti kuramıyoruz Batsın Bu Dünya :D

    YanıtlaSil
  16. Kicklerken bir süre sonra giriş gibi bi cvar komutu yokmu acaba?
    Mesela rr çekeene kick atsın msj dada 5 saniye sonra tekrar dene dese zaten oyuna girer fakat o ele dahil olamaz zaten doğal olarak yada 10 saniye işte ?

    YanıtlaSil
  17. @uğur

    Konudaki cvarlar dışında bahsettiğin cvar desteği yok maalesef

    YanıtlaSil
  18. amx_retrytime "10"
    amx_retrykick "1"
    amx_retryshow "1"
    amx_retrychat "1"
    amx_retrymsg "Israrla RETRY atiyorsun , %s"
    amx_retrykickmsg "retry_yasak_3_saniye_bekle_gir."
    amx_retrychatmsg "%s retry attigi icin kicklendi tekrar %t saniye sonra girecek"

    Bunları server.cfg ye attım gayet stabil çalışıyor. Sma dan düzeltsekde yemiyodu böyle çözdüm sorunumu ben. Geceleri sw yedek alırken kapanıp açıldığında def değer olan 60 saniye oluyodu kick saniyesi.

    YanıtlaSil